What if understanding isn’t the problem—being heard is?

Real Words With Sam tells the true story of a father who, after two decades, discovers that his autistic son has been fully aware, perceptive, and engaged all along. Through spelled communication, Sam’s inner voice emerges, revealing insight, humor, and emotional depth that challenge long-standing assumptions about disability and intelligence. What many experts labeled as “behaviors” and a “learning disorder” is actually apraxia—a condition affecting output, not input or understanding.

Father and son move beyond managing autism toward building a relationship rooted in mutual respect and curiosity. Deeply vulnerable, raw, and humble, this is both an intimate father-son story and an invitation to rethink how we define communication, competence, and connection—and to ask how many other voices may be waiting to be heard.

Far from a dry, clinical assessment of therapies available for autistic children, Real Words with Sam grabbed my attention from the start with its honest admission of skepticism. It then kept me engaged through its compelling rhythm and stark, memorable vignettes from the lives of Sam and his family.

Additionally, while authors often do a poor job narrating their own work—frequently lacking breath control or proper pacing—that is happily not the case here. Brad Britton’s narration makes for a thoroughly satisfying listening experience.
